Abstract
The X-ray detection efficiencies at off-center points on the surface of Si(Li) detectors were found to be dependent on the distance from the center. The dependence of the efficiency ε{lunate}(r) on the radial distance can be approximated by the equation ε{lunate}(r) = ε{lunate}0 exp (-αr2) where α is a constant, characteristics of the detector, and is a linearly decreasing function of the inverse of the energy of the X-ray. The efficiencies for homogeneous disc, line or rectangular radioactive sources were calculated.
